About pr-agent

PR Agent is an open source, AI powered code review agent, maintained by the community as a legacy project of Qodo, for development teams that want automated pull request review running on their own infrastructure with their own model keys.

About Encore

Encore is an open source infrastructure platform for backend development, written in Go under MPL 2.0. It lives in the Go and TypeScript cloud native ecosystem and lets developers declare databases, Pub/Sub, object storage, caches, cron jobs, and secrets in application code. The project combines an infrastructure SDK with an optional managed platform that deploys to a user's AWS or GCP account.
